Audiobook Adventures: Unfu*k Yourself: Get Out of Your Head and Into Your Life

I was looking forward to diving into this one in time for the new year. You know, "New year, new me" and all that fluff. But this book under delivered. It was a tiresome 3-hour book if you ask me. 

(But if you happen to jive with books like this, I'm sorry, but do read on. It was simply not for me.)

I think the books gets by with the shock value provided by the title. It's just one looooong book of pep talks, in my opinion, could've been summed up in far less pages. Being told YES YOU CAN is great and all but I guess I was after for more substance. A collection of pep talks can only go so far. 

It was repetitive. Where's the evidence based research to back up your claims? The author basically talks of things I already fundamentally know as a person but have trouble practicing. For example, incorporating exercise in your every day is necessary to keep your mind and body healthy but it is hard to do. The answer? Get off your lazy ass and just do it. Well dang it, why didn't I think of that before?! MIND BLOWING MATERIAL RIGHT THERE. 

Seriously though. This book offers nothing new. I guess I can say this because I'm not new to this genre. I have books and even podcasts that offer similar content but with more meat. It tells you the WHYs of your actions/mindset and HOW you can improve/get over them. They offer a well-rounded approach. This to me feels more like a jumping point. I think I'm just way past that point to find this book useful.
